Omani Bank Assets Grow 22% 

The total assets of the 22 commercial banks in the Sultanate of Oman grew by 22% during 1984 to reach RO1,167bn ($3.4bn) at the end of the year according to the results published by the banks. Total deposits grew by 19% to reach RO816mn ($2.4bn) while total loans were RO614mn ($1.8bn), up 18% on the previous year.
